This Actor Was Set to Play the MLA in Ravi Teja’s Irumudi – Here’s Why It Changed

Published on Friday, 11 Sep 2026 08:58 AM

Mass Maharaja Ravi Teja’s Irumudi has turned out to be a massive blockbuster at the box office. The film received a strong response from audiences for its emotional content and performances. The movie has also crossed the Rs. 200 crore gross mark worldwide.

The makers recently celebrated the film’s success. During the event, actor Ajay Ghosh revealed an interesting detail about his role. Ajay Ghosh said that he was initially offered the MLA role, which is an important character in the film. However, after discussions with director Shiva Nirvana, the producers and Ravi Teja, he was offered another role.

The reason was simple. The makers felt that audiences might easily guess that Ajay Ghosh was the negative character if he played the MLA, based on the kind of roles he has played earlier. So, they decided to cast another actor as the MLA and gave Ajay Ghosh a different role.

The film stars Ravi Teja, Priya Bhavani Shankar, Baby Nakshathra, Sai Kumar, Swasika Vijay, and others. It is produced by Mythri Movie Makers, with music by GV Prakash Kumar. Irumudi is now gearing up for its OTT release on Netflix.
